Job Summary

The Maintenance Manager is responsible for planning, directing, and overseeing all facilities engineering and maintenance operations. This role leads maintenance staff, contractors, and vendors while partnering with the Director and/or Operations Manager to ensure safe, reliable, and compliant facility operations. The Manager sets priorities, allocates resources, and ensures preventive and corrective maintenance activities align with organizational goals. This position is accountable for workforce performance, asset reliability, regulatory compliance, and continuous improvement.

Technical expertise is applied primarily for oversight, mentoring, troubleshooting, and quality assurance.

Key Responsibilities
  • Lead, coach, and develop licensed and non‑licensed maintenance staff.
  • Assign daily work, manage priorities, evaluate performance, support training, and promote safe work practices.
  • Determine staffing, materials, and timelines for maintenance and capital projects.
  • Serve as the primary maintenance contact in coordination with leadership.
  • Oversee maintenance, repair, and operation of HVAC, electrical, mechanical, fire alarm, sprinkler, transport systems, sterilizers, and food service equipment.
  • Ensure all work meets applicable codes, standards, and licensing requirements.
  • Review contractor work for quality and compliance and recommend repair or replacement strategies.
  • Provide technical guidance for complex building system issues.
  • Review drawings and specifications, support renovations and system upgrades, and maintain compliance with safety, life safety, and infection control standards.
  • Ensure effective use of the CMMS, monitoring work orders, preventive maintenance, and asset documentation.
  • Analyze CMMS data to improve reliability and reduce downtime. Lead emergency maintenance response and participate in on‑call rotation.
Qualifications
  • High school diploma required; trade or vocational training preferred.
  • Minimum five years of progressive facilities maintenance experience with prior supervisory experience.
  • Must hold a journeyman‑level electrical, HVAC (EPA certified), or plumbing license; master license preferred or required where applicable.
  • Strong knowledge of building systems, CMMS, vendor management, and ability to read technical documentation.
  • Valid driver’s license and ability to work nights, weekends, and emergency call‑ins as required.
